In Memory of
Manuel "Catz" Catzoela
April 23, 1948 - February 22, 2013
Manuel Catzoela, Jr. also known as "Manny" to his family and "Catz" to his friends passed on
Friday, February 22, 2013, in Luling, TX. Manny is preceded in death by his
father Manuel Catzoela, Sr. He is survived by his mother Enrica Dy Catzoela and
his 5 brothers: Frank, Charles, Bob, Tony, Ernie, and 3 sisters: Nenita
Ritualo, Elaine Dean, and Vickie Arzola, and brother-in-laws Oscar Ritualo, Dan
Dean, sister-in-laws Carmen Catzoela and Linda Catzoela. Manny also had 8
nephews, 3 nieces, 3 grandnieces and 3 grandnephews.
Manny was born in New York City, but spent his formative years in the Canal
Zone. He graduated from Balboa High School and attended Canal Zone Junior
College and later North Texas State University. While attending NTSU he
enlisted in the United States Army. As a helicopter pilot, he served in the
Vietnam War and achieved the rank of CW2. He was a highly decorated officer,
receiving numerous medals, awards and commendations, including the Silver Star,
Bronze Star, Purple Heart and Meritorious Service Medal. He finally settled
down in Houston, Texas working for Re-Align Industries.
